Ralph Lauren Corporation (NYSE:RL) is a global leader in the design, marketing and distribution of premium lifestyle products in five categories: apparel, accessories, home, fragrances, and hospitality. For more than 50 years, Ralph Lauren's reputation and distinctive image have been consistently developed across an expanding number of products, brands and international markets. The Company's brand names, which include Ralph Lauren, Ralph Lauren Collection, Ralph Lauren Purple Label, Polo Ralph Lauren, Double RL, Lauren Ralph Lauren, Polo Ralph Lauren Children, Chaps, among others, constitute one of the world's most widely recognized families of consumer brands.

Position Overview

We are looking for a Senior Business Process Manager - Inventory to support  the design and implementation of demand & supply related business processes in our SAP S/4HANA transformation. This role will focus on optimizing cross-channel fulfillment in an omni-channel shared inventory environment by aligning business requirements with SAP S/4HANA capabilities.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

  • Design and optimize cross-channel fulfillment processes, including:
    • Demand/supply alignment and exception handling
    • Delivery and revenue forecasting
    • Inventory allocation across wholesale (WHS) and direct-to-consumer (DTC) channels
    • Cross-dock operations
    • Omni-channel inventory visibility and availability
  • Represent business needs in transformation initiatives, ensuring clear articulation and prioritization of requirements
  • Partner with IT, supply chain, logistics, and commercial teams to enable seamless end-to-end process integration
  • Support business-led testing, training, and change management activities
  • Track post-implementation performance and lead continuous improvement efforts
